W. A. Farmer is a scholar working on Nuclear and High Energy Physics, Astronomy and Astrophysics and Mechanics of Materials. According to data from OpenAlex, W. A. Farmer has authored 43 papers receiving a total of 412 indexed citations (citations by other indexed papers that have themselves been cited), including 35 papers in Nuclear and High Energy Physics, 14 papers in Astronomy and Astrophysics and 12 papers in Mechanics of Materials. Recurrent topics in W. A. Farmer’s work include Laser-Plasma Interactions and Diagnostics (22 papers), Magnetic confinement fusion research (21 papers) and Ionosphere and magnetosphere dynamics (14 papers). W. A. Farmer is often cited by papers focused on Laser-Plasma Interactions and Diagnostics (22 papers), Magnetic confinement fusion research (21 papers) and Ionosphere and magnetosphere dynamics (14 papers). W. A. Farmer collaborates with scholars based in United States, Canada and France. W. A. Farmer's co-authors include M. D. Rosen, O. S. Jones, D. J. Strozzi, G. J. Morales, Kumar Ankit, D. E. Hinkel, J. M. Koning, D. D. Ryutov, J. H. Hammer and M. A. Barrios and has published in prestigious journals such as Physical Review Letters, Journal of Applied Physics and Journal of Computational Physics.
